Where Should You Place a Compact Dehumidifier for the Best Results?

Using a compact dehumidifier is a smart way to control excess moisture in your home, office, or small work area. But to get the best performance, where you place your dehumidifier matters. Here’s how to choose the perfect place for your compact dehumidifier.


1. Identify the Dampest Areas

Start by locating the areas where you notice:

  • Damp smells or musty odors

  • Water stains on walls or ceilings

  • Condensation on windows

  • Mold or mildew spots

Common moisture hotspots include bathrooms, kitchens, basements, laundry rooms, and storerooms.


2. Keep It Away from Walls and Furniture

For best airflow, place the dehumidifier at least 6 to 12 inches away from walls, furniture, or curtains. This allows air to circulate freely in and out of the unit, improving efficiency.


3. Choose the Center of the Room (If Possible)

If the dampness is spread throughout the room, position the dehumidifier in the center. For small rooms, placing it in an open corner facing the center can work well too.


4. Near Moisture Sources

Place your dehumidifier near sources of humidity, such as:

  • Bathrooms (outside of direct water contact)

  • Near washing machines or dryers

  • Close to kitchen sinks (away from splashes)

This helps capture moisture before it spreads around the room.


5. Use Closed Spaces for Better Results

For quicker results, keep windows and doors closed while using the dehumidifier. Open spaces make it harder for a small unit to reduce moisture levels effectively.


6. In Bedrooms for Better Sleep

Placing a compact dehumidifier in your bedroom helps with breathing, reduces allergens like dust mites, and improves sleep. Just make sure it’s positioned far enough from your bed to avoid noise disturbance.


7. Elevate If Needed

If the floor tends to stay cooler or damp (like in basements), place the unit on a small table or shelf. This helps capture humid air more efficiently from higher points in the room.


Extra Tips for Best Results

  • Clean the filter regularly to maintain good airflow.

  • Empty the water tank daily if humidity levels are high.

  • For larger spaces, consider using more than one compact unit.
